LEARNING TAKES PLACE IN QUALITY ASSURANCE

The Canadian Safety Management System (SMS) is designed to

continuously improve aviation safety by identifying hazards, managing risk,

monitoring performance, and learning from operational experience. Among

the six SMS components, Training and Quality Assurance perform

complementary but distinctly different functions. Although they are often

discussed together, they serve different purposes within an effective safety

management system. Training provides individuals with the knowledge,

skills, and procedures required to perform their duties safely, while Quality

Assurance determines whether those duties are being performed

effectively and whether improvements are required. In practical terms,

training prepares people to do the job, while Quality Assurance enables

both individuals and organizations to learn how to do the job better.


This continuous learning

process distinguishes

Quality Assurance from

Training. Training answers

the question, "What should

people know before

performing the task?"

Quality Assurance answers

the question, "What have

we learned after

performing the task?" Both

questions are essential, but

they occur at different stages of organizational performance.


For commercial pilots, this distinction is particularly important. Every flight

provides opportunities to learn. Weather conditions differ, airports present

unique challenges, aircraft systems behave differently, passengers

introduce varying operational demands, and human performance changes

with fatigue, workload, and environmental conditions. Training cannot

anticipate every possible situation a pilot will encounter throughout a

career. Instead, training provides the foundation that enables pilots to

safely manage situations they have never previously experienced. Quality

Assurance then captures those experiences, analyzes them, and

determines whether improvements should be made to procedures, training

programs, documentation, or operational practices.


Hazard reporting and occurrence reporting illustrate this relationship. Pilots

are responsible for reporting hazards, incidents, operational concerns,

procedural difficulties, and safety observations encountered during normal

operations. These reports are not simply records of what happened; they become learning opportunities for the entire organization. Quality Assurance reviews the reports, identifies trends, evaluates risk controls, determines whether existing procedures remain effective, and

recommends improvements where necessary. The knowledge gained from

these reports becomes organizational learning that benefits current and

future employees.


Training alone cannot

create continuous

improvement because it is

based primarily on

existing knowledge.

Quality Assurance

expands that knowledge

by examining actual

operational performance.

When recurring hazards

are identified, corrective

actions are implemented,

procedures are revised, and future training is updated to reflect new

understanding. In this way, Quality Assurance continuously strengthens the

Training component by ensuring that training materials remain accurate,

relevant, and based on operational experience rather than assumptions.


The relationship between Training and Quality Assurance components is

therefore cyclical rather than independent. Training prepares employees to

operate safely. Operational experience generates information. Quality

Assurance analyzes that information and produces lessons learned. Those

lessons are incorporated into revised procedures, documentation, and

updated training programs. Employees then receive improved trainingbased on real operational experience, completing a continuous cycle of

organizational learning and improvement.


This relationship also reflects one of the fundamental principles of modern

Safety Management Systems: safety is not achieved simply by complying

with procedures but by continually evaluating whether those procedures

remain effective. Regulations establish minimum requirements, but Quality

Assurance determines whether the organization's actual performance

meets or exceeds those expectations. Whenever gaps are identified,

learning occurs, and improvements follow.


For pilots, learning extends

beyond technical flying

skills. It includes decision

making, communication,

crew coordination, workload

management, situational

awareness, hazard

recognition, and operational

judgment. Many of these

skills continue to develop

throughout an entire career

because they are refined through reflection, feedback, investigation, and practical experience rather than classroom instruction alone. Quality Assurance provides the structured process that captures these experiences and transforms them into measurable safety improvements. Organizational learning also supports a proactive safety culture. Rather

than waiting for accidents to reveal weaknesses, Quality Assurance

encourages organizations to learn from routine operations, minor occurrences, hazard reports, audits, observations, and performance monitoring. This proactive approach identifies opportunities for improvement before serious consequences occur. Employees become

active participants in improving safety instead of passive recipients of

training.


Training and Quality Assurance are not viewed as competing components.

Training establishes competence, while Quality Assurance develops

capability. Training teaches employees what is currently known, whereas

Quality Assurance discovers what still needs to be learned. Training

transfers knowledge from the organization to the employee; Quality

Assurance transfers knowledge from operational experience back to the

organization. Together they create a continuous cycle of improvement that

strengthens both individual performance and organizational safety.

Within the Canadian Safety Management System, this distinction is

fundamental. 


Training provides pilots with the knowledge, skills, and

responsibilities necessary to begin operating safely within Canada's

aviation system. Quality Assurance ensures that those operations are

continuously evaluated, that hazards and occurrences become

opportunities for learning, and that the lessons gained from everyday

operations improve future procedures, documentation, risk management,

and training. The result is a Safety Management System that does more

than teach people how to work safely, it enables the entire organization to

continually learn how to become safer.
